St. Louis Cardinals Betting Preview

The St. Louis Cardinals are 1-0 this year after they defeated the Twins by a score of 5-3 in their first game. St. Louis scored in each of the first three innings, and they were able to add an insurance run in the eighth to secure the victory. The Cardinals recorded 10 hits in the game, but they only drew two walks. Nootbaar went 2-4 with one home run and two RBIs in the game, while Donovan, Arenado, and Herrera added two hits and one RBI each. Sonny Gray started on the mound for St. Louis, and he allowed four hits and two earned runs over five innings of work, while Helsley struck out three batters in the ninth inning for the save. 

Last year, the St. Louis pitching staff had a 4.04 ERA with a 1.26 WHIP and a .249 opponent batting average, while the offense scored 672 runs with a .248 batting average and a .312 on-base percentage. The Cardinals were ranked 22nd in the MLB in runs scored last season and need to find more consistent hitting this year. St. Louis was led by Paul Goldschmidt last season, but he is no longer with the team, while Alec Burleson hit .269 with 21 home runs and 78 RBIs. The projected starting pitcher for St. Louis is Erick Fedde, who went 2-5 with a 3.72 ERA and a 1.20 WHIP over 55.2 innings for the Cardinals last year. After this series, the Cardinals will meet the Angels and Red Sox.

Minnesota Twins Betting Preview

The Minnesota Twins are 0-1 this season after they lost to St. Louis in their first game of the season on Thursday. Minnesota allowed runs in the first three innings, but they did score three runs in the fifth/sixth innings but couldn’t find any more offense in the loss. The Twins recorded eight hits in the game but did commit one error. Larnach went 2-3 with one walk in the game, while Bader had two RBIs, and Castro added one RBI. Pablo Lopez started for the Twins in game one of the series, and he allowed eight hits and two earned runs over 5.0 innings pitched, while Jax allowed one hit and one earned run over 0.2 innings late in the game. 

Last season, the Minnesota pitching staff had a 4.26 ERA with a 1.23 WHIP and a .242 opponent batting average, while their offense scored 742 runs with a .246 batting average and a .315 on-base percentage. Minnesota was 10th in the MLB in runs scored last year, but just 21st in team ERA. The Twins were led by Carlos Santana last season, but he is no longer on the team, while Ryan Jeffers hit .226 with 21 home runs and 64 RBIs. The projected starting pitcher for Minnesota is Joe Ryan, who went 7-7 with a 3.60 ERA and a 0.99 WHIP over 135.0 innings pitched for the Twins last year. After this series, the Twins will head to the South Side to take on the Chicago White Sox
